        FRANCE: WEARABLE AI MARKET, BY APPLICATION, 2024–2029

        Segment202420252026202720282029CAGR (%)
        CONSUMER ELECTRONICS1110.11238.41403.81615.61847.82122.113.8
        ENTERPRISE & INDUSTRIAL371.6425.9495.4585685.6806.716.8
        HEALTHCARE465.8512.9573.1648.3727.7816.811.9
        OTHER APPLICATIONS60.561.462.764.364.463.50.9
        TOTAL2008.12238.72535.12913.23325.63809.113.7

        RESEARCH METHODOLOGY

        The study involved four major activities in estimating the size for wearable AI market. Exhaustive secondary research was done to collect information on the market, peer market, and parent market. The next step was to validate these findings, assumptions, and sizing with industry experts across value chains through primary research. The bottom-up approach was employed to estimate the overall market size. After that, market breakdown and data triangulation were used to estimate the market size of segments and subsegments.

        Secondary Research

        In the secondary research process, sources such as annual reports, press releases, investor presentations of companies, white papers, and articles by recognized authors were referred to. Secondary research was done to obtain key information about the market’s supply chain, the market's value chain, the pool of key market players, and market segmentation according to industry trends, region, and developments from both market and technology perspectives.

        Primary Research

        Extensive primary research has been conducted after understanding and analyzing the wearable AI market scenario through secondary research. Several primary interviews have been conducted with key opinion leaders from demand- and supply-side vendors across four major regions—North America, Europe, Asia Pacific, and RoW. Approximately 25% of primary interviews have been conducted with the demand side and 75% with the supply side. These primary data have been collected through telephonic interviews, questionnaires, and emails.

        Definition

        Wearable AI refers to artificial intelligence integrated into wearable devices, which are typically worn on the body, such as smartwatches, fitness trackers, wearable camera, smart earwear, augmented reality/virtual reality (AR/VR) headsets, and other similar accessories. These devices are designed to collect data from the user's movements, activities, and surroundings, and then utilize AI algorithms to analyze and interpret that data in real-time.

        The primary goal of wearable AI is to enhance the functionality of the wearable device by providing personalized and context-aware information, insights, and services to the user. This can include features like health and fitness tracking, notifications, voice recognition, gesture control, and more. Wearable AI leverages machine learning and other AI technologies to understand user behavior, preferences, and patterns, adapting to the individual's needs and delivering a more tailored and intuitive user experience.
